Hi everyone! Thank you all so much for the feedback provided so far! Everyone here at ProBoards is hard at work on v6 and your feedback is invaluable to us. We can achieve so much when we all work together! I'm excited to announce that in order to help us get things done better and faster, we are collaborating with Kami to improve and overhaul some of our designs that you see in ProBoards v6 and across ProBoards as a whole. Kami has been a member of ProBoards for a long time, and has shown everyone on ProBoards what can be achieved with an innovative forum design, while remaining entirely familiar and accessible to everyone. Her expertise is invaluable, and we cannot wait to see what we can achieve together! You will see Kami across the v6 beta boards here, providing you with information or asking questions to help us focus on what matters to everyone the most - making sure the design of v6 is modern and accessible to everyone. Please don't PM Kami with v6-related question - the v6 beta board and especially the v6 Feedback board are dedicated areas for anything you might want to ask, discuss or provide feedback on.We truly appreciate her in assisting us as we move forwards with v6 beta and we hope you'll enjoy what we will be bringing to you in the near future!

Hi Kittykat :), Thank you for the feedback! Let me begin my response by stating that we have never, and will never hold anyone's opinion against them, so please feel free to speak your mind and we will always try to address it. You do not have to worry about being banned or any reprecussions of any kind and your post will not be removed. As Kami has said, you are certainly not out of line - and I accept full responsibility for not posting more frequent updates. The reality is that I need to dedicate more time to this area. Unfortunately being a small team and having to coordinate everything together is far more time consuming than it might sound. Please don't take this as an excuse as it absolutely is a failure on my part, merely trying to provide some context for easier understanding. The latest available beta version is currently not only available on created forums, but also here on ProBoards Support. Any distinct updates would also be reflected here if and when they occur as well as noted on the Development Blog. As such there is no significant development other than bug fixes and functionality/usability changes at this time - the main priority of the test is figuring out issues in general use while v6 is in a v5-equivalent state. This includes things like post creation, basic admin management, and even forum creation itself, all of which are completely changed in v6 and thus available in a very limited capacity. With that said, behind the scenes we have been working on some rather large new functionality that will be coming to the beta very soon, including some features that have been brought into v5. In the past when we decided to add a feature, we made the mistake of announcing it too early (just like with v6), we are now being extremely cautious with announcements. We truly appreciate your thoughts and your feedback and know that you have not gone unheard. We will be posting the first of the brand new feature announcements in the last week of June (2 weeks from today), followed by several others in the weeks after that, culminating in the next phase of the beta test. I hope you'll find the features exciting, and I hope to hear your thoughts! Please feel free to PM me at any time in the future with any questions or thoughts. You are also welcome to post in the respective v6 boards, if you'd prefer a more public discussion. I am more than happy to answer any questions, or hear your feedback!
